Official abstract text for this publication.
An electrode includes a base material, and a catalyst layer provided on the base material, the catalyst layer including a plurality of catalyst units having a porous structure. The catalyst layer has a first catalyst layer provided near the base material, the first catalyst layer including a plurality of the catalyst units dispersed at a first dispersion degree. The catalyst layer has a second catalyst layer provided above the first catalyst layer, the second catalyst layer including a plurality of the catalyst units dispersed at a second dispersion degree. The second dispersion degree is different from the first dispersion degree.

What is claimed is: 1 . An electrode comprising: a base material; and a catalyst layer provided on the base material, the catalyst layer including a plurality of catalyst units having a porous structure, wherein the catalyst layer has a first catalyst layer provided near the base material, the first catalyst layer including a plurality of the catalyst units dispersed at a first dispersion degree, and a second catalyst layer provided above the first catalyst layer, the second catalyst layer including a plurality of the catalyst units dispersed at a second dispersion degree, and wherein the second dispersion degree is different from the first dispersion degree. 2 . The electrode according to claim 1 , wherein the second dispersion degree is higher than the first dispersion degree. 3 . The electrode according to claim 1 , wherein the catalyst layer has an intermediate layer between the first catalyst layer and the second catalyst layer. 4 . The electrode according to claim 1 , wherein the catalyst layer has a porosity of not less than 50 vol % and not more than 95 vol %. 5 . The electrode according to claim 1 , wherein an average distance between the catalyst units in the second catalyst layer is not less than 30 nm and not more than 2000 nm. 6 . The electrode according to claim 1 , wherein the catalyst units of the first catalyst layer include at least one of iridium oxide, ruthenium oxide, tantalum oxide, titanium oxide, platinum, and platinum oxide. 7 . The electrode according to claim 1 , wherein an average height of the catalyst units of the second catalyst layer is not less than 30 nm and not more than 1000 nm. 8 . The electrode according to claim 1 , wherein not less than 50 vol % of the catalyst units of the second catalyst layer is platinum, and not less than 60 vol % of the catalyst units of the first catalyst layer is iridium oxide. 9 . A membrane electrode assembly comprising the electrode according to claim 1 and a electrolyte membrane. 10 . The assembly according to claim 9 , wherein the second catalyst layer exists between the first catalyst layer and the electrolyte membrane. 11 . The assembly according to claim 9 , wherein the electrolyte membrane is in physical contact with the second catalyst layer. 12 . An electrochemical cell comprising the membrane electrode assembly according to claim 9 . 13 . A stack including the electrochemical cell according to claim 12 .
